NOTCH3 coactivator complex binds the RBPJ (CSL) response elements in the promoter of the DLGAP5 gene. Two adjacent CSL-binding motifs in the DLGAP5 promoter, which are 6 bp apart, are both necessary for NOTCH3-mediated induction of DLGAP5 transcription (Chen et al. 2012).
